New York / Chichester / Weinheim / Brisbane / Sing: John Wiley & Sons, Inc, 1998. FIRST EDITION. Hardcover. Very Good/Very Good. First Edition, 1998. A chronicle of Noah Webster as a patriot, schoolmaster, author, essayist, public servant, editor, philosopher, lexicographer and public statesman. xxiii, Epilogue, Notes, Selected Bibliography, Index, 386 pp. Condition: Black boards, gilt title on spine. Illustrated dust jacket entitled in white front and spine. Slight jacket edge wear; flaps are pasted to inside covers. Previous owner stamp on endpapers and title page. No other writing within.
